Why the Same Gasket Set Number Ships in Multiple Variants Across Deutz Engines

An upper gasket set for Deutz F4M1011 TCD2011L4 cross reference demands serial-level verification, not just a part number match.

In Southeast Asian field operations, I have watched a machine sit idle for days because the gasket set matched the manual number but not the actual engine block casting. The Deutz 1011 and 2011 families share base architecture, yet oil gallery routing, coolant port placement, and head bolt patterns shifted across production years. A cross-reference table copied from one supplier to another often carries forward superseded numbers without flagging which engine serial ranges they actually cover [NEED_CITE: Deutz engine serial range identification for gasket set selection]. When the old gasket is already torn or the nameplate is painted over, the margin for error widens further.

Cylinder Head Gasket Material and Sealing Profile Matched to Engine Variant

The cylinder head gaskets in this set are selected to match the combustion pressure and thermal load of each Deutz variant. Turbocharged models like the TCD2011L4 and BF4L1011FT generate higher peak cylinder pressures, requiring multi-layer steel or reinforced composite gasket construction with specific bore beading profiles. Naturally aspirated variants such as the F4L2011 operate under lower thermal stress, where a single-layer gasket with elastomer coating provides adequate sealing. Valve cover seals and associated upper engine seals in the kit are matched to the rail geometry and fastener spacing of each cylinder head casting, preventing oil weeping at the cover-to-head joint.

What Happens When the Wrong Variant Goes on the Block

An upper gasket set that physically bolts down but has misaligned coolant ports creates a slow-burn failure: localized overheating around one or two cylinders, head warping over weeks of operation, and eventually a blown head gasket that destroys the new work. Oil gallery misalignment is subtler β€” the engine runs, but starved lubrication to the valve train produces premature cam and rocker wear. These failures rarely show up at startup. They appear after the machine returns to the site, turning a planned overhaul into an unplanned teardown [NEED_CITE: cylinder head gasket failure modes in diesel engines]. The cost is not the gasket itself but the second round of labor, machine downtime, and potential head resurfacing.

Fitment Check Before Installation

  • Compare cylinder head gasket bore diameter and coolant hole positions against the old gasket or bare block surface
  • Verify valve cover seal profile matches the rail geometry on your specific Deutz cylinder head casting
  • Check all fastener hole positions on the head gasket against the block bolt pattern before applying sealant
  • Lay every seal from the kit on a clean bench and confirm no items are missing before starting assembly
  • If any port or hole shows even partial misalignment, stop and request cross-reference re-verification with your engine serial
